Is Budbrooke a good place to live?

Budbrooke may be a good fit for people who value lower crime and stronger school performance. It ranks strongly for lower crime and stronger school performance, while flood risk is around the national middle range. Transport access appears weaker, so those factors are worth checking against your priorities.

Is Budbrooke safe?

Budbrooke ranks in the 94th percentile for crime data; in this dataset, a higher percentile indicates lower crime.

What are house prices like in Budbrooke?

The average sold price is £360,780, with house prices in the 67th percentile nationally.

How are schools in Budbrooke?

Schools rank in the 82nd percentile nationally for this public profile.
